Skip to content

GDRAWG

関数名 引数 戻り値
GDRAWG int, int, int, int, int, int, int, int, int, int int
int, int, int, int, int, int, int, int, int, int, integerVariable int

API

int GDRAWG destID, srcID, destX, destY, destWidth, destHeight, srcX, srcY, srcWidth, srcHeight
int GDRAWG destID, srcID, destX, destY, destWidth, destHeight, srcX, srcY, srcWidth, srcHeight, colorMatrix
指定したdestIDGraphicsに、指定したsrcIDGraphicsを描画します。
描画先destGraphicsの位置及びサイズを4つの整数で、描画元srcGraphicsの位置及びサイズを4つの整数で指定します。
オプションとして、5x5以上の二次元数値配列をcolorMatrixとして指定することでカラーマトリクスを適用して描画します。
colorMatrixは全要素を1/256にして.Net FrameworkのColorMatrixクラスに渡されます。つまり、対角がすべて256である5x5行列が単位行列になります。
処理に成功した場合、非0を返します。
描画先Graphics又は描画元Graphicsのいずれかが未作成であるなどの場合、0を返します。
描画先と描画元Graphicsは同一でも実行可能です。

ヒント

命令、式中関数両方対応しています。

関連項目